Fixtures: (click image to save to your phone’s camera roll for handy reference on the day) 

Non – competitive Blitz format, scores will be kept by the referees but there will be no outright winner.

Teams are 5 a side mixed.

Unlimited substitution, please use all the players you bring.

Schools will receive winner’s medals at the end of the blitz.

Normal GAA rules apply with our Cumann na mBunscol adaptations….

Player has one bounce and one solo or two solos, and has to pass or kick.

Frees, 45s and kick-outs may all be taken from the hand.

Your goalkeeper should take all kick outs.

There is no square ball rule or penalties, all close in frees are 13 m.

Results Round Up | Cumann na mBunscol Mhaigh Eo Hurling Finals 2017 #MayoGAA @Allianzireland

Aghamore Capt

Over two days, four Allianz Cumann na mBunscol Hurling titles were decided in the home of Mayo GAA.

Undoubtedly inspired by the heroics of the Mayo Senior Hurlers’ terrific Nicky Rackard success last summer and indeed this year’s Christy Ring survival, MacHale Park bore witness to four brilliant finals.

Schools in traditional Mayo hurling strongholds such as Tooreen, Westport and Castlebar featured heavily as well as the ever emerging Cashel Gales, in our Division 1, 2 and 3 finals. It was wonderful also to see Manulla NS and Cloonlyon NS contest the Division 4 final, a testament to the development work going on in our schools under the stewardship of Adrian Hession.

Special mention must go to Aghamore and Manulla who were crowned double champions winning both football and hurling in their respective divisions. Aghamore also won our Sports Quiz last January!

Full results:

Div 2 (9-a-side) Final

KILMOVEE NS 3-5 V 0-2 TOOREEN NS

Div 1 (11-a-side) Final

AGHAMORE NS 8-12 V 2-3 GAELSCOIL NA CRUAICHE` CATHAIR NA MART

Div 3 (7-a-side) Final

SCOIL RAIFTEIRÍ, GORT NA FUARAIN 4-0 V 6-8 DERNABROOK NS

Div 4 (6-a-side) Final

CLOONLYON NS 0-1 V 3-3 MANULLA NS
